This ultimately depends on what you’re looking for. Both apps feature tools that help people meditate, relax, and sleep. The Calm app is geared more towards relaxation and sleep, and it features several sleep stories narrated by famous figures. Headspace is a better choice for people who want to learn how to meditate.

Headspace is our overall winner because whether you’re a meditation newbie or a seasoned pro looking for some structure, the app is jam-packed with meditations, sleep and nature sounds, calming music, guided self-help courses, and more. Headspace may be a better choice for beginners and people looking for an app that offers plenty of quick meditations for folks who are short on time. Although it costs more, Calm may be a better fit for those with some meditation experience or advanced meditators, as it has less structure. Anxiety can trigger your flight-or-fight stress response and release a flood of chemicals and hormones, like adrenaline, into your system. In the short term, this increases your pulse and breathing rate, so your brain can get more oxygen. This prepares you to respond appropriately to an intense situation. The free version of Calm includes timed meditation options (in the ‘Less Guidance’ category found under the ‘Meditation’ button of the ‘Discover’ menu), Day 1 of all our multi-day meditation programs (such as 7 Days of Focus or 21 Days of Calm), one of our Breathing Exercises, and our Sleep Story titled Blue Gold ( … Not only does Calm record your stats, such as the number of sessions you’ve completed, it also allows you to track your mood over time more frequently than Headspace does. There’s also a robust section for kids. But Calm is less organized and more difficult to navigate than Headspace. Mindfulness meditation is a technique that can relax the mind and body to help manage stress and anxiety. Mindfulness meditation strives to focus the mind on the present moment, allowing it to notice sensations and feelings without evaluating them.
